Stargate Project Launched: $500 Billion AI Investment by OpenAI, Oracle, and SoftBank

The tech industry is buzzing with excitement following the announcement of the Stargate Project, which will see OpenAI, Oracle, and SoftBank team up to invest $500 billion over the next four years to build cutting-edge artificial intelligence infrastructure across the United States. This ambitious venture was unveiled by President Trump during a White House event, marking the beginning of what is anticipated to be one of the largest investments in AI technology to date.

The initial phase of the project will kick off with $100 billion immediately allocated for the construction of data centers, starting with the first facility located in Texas. This venture is not merely about financial investment; it promises to drive economic growth by creating hundreds of thousands of new jobs and bolstering the U.S. position as a global leader in AI.

"This monumental undertaking is a resounding declaration of confidence in America's potential under a new president," Trump said at the announcement. He emphasized the project's importance, stating it would not only fuel innovation but also serve as a strategic measure to maintain national security and safeguard the U.S. against global competition, particularly from China.

According to reports, the Stargate Project is backed by some of the biggest names in tech. SoftBank CEO Masayoshi Son, OpenAI chief Sam Altman, and Oracle Chairman Larry Ellison are leading the charge, with Son taking on the chairmanship of the project. The stellar lineup of initial partners includes notable tech giants like Microsoft and NVIDIA, underscoring the collaboration's strength.

OpenAI's role is twofold; it will manage operational aspects of the initiative, leveraging its experience and expertise to develop AI and AGI solutions. "I think this will be the most important project of this era," Altman stated, highlighting the transformative potential of AI technology. Meanwhile, Oracle is set to power the infrastructure components, ensuring sufficient computing resources for transformative AI applications.

The collaboration signals a shift toward more aggressive governmental support for the AI sector. On Trump's first day back in office, he signed several executive orders, including measures to reduce regulations surrounding AI safety, which previously mandated companies like OpenAI to disclose safety testing results to the federal government. These regulatory changes have been seen as favorable by stakeholders, creating a more favorable environment for AI development.

Investors reacted positively to the news, boosting the stock prices of Oracle and SoftBank, reflecting market optimism about the joint venture's potential. Oracle's stock surged by over 7% following the announcement, as investors sought to capitalize on the prospective economic growth stemming from the Stargate initiative.
